4. The Interface and Ascend Protocol

4.1 Protocol Description

The Ascend Protocol is a decentralized, non-custodial liquid staking protocol deployed on 0G Chain (the “Protocol”). The Protocol enables users to stake 0G tokens with validator node operators and receive a0G liquid staking tokens (“a0G”) representing their proportional interest in the Protocol’s aggregated staking pool. The Interface is a front-end convenience layer for interacting with the Protocol’s deployed smart contracts; it is not the Protocol itself. Ascend does not operate, manage, or directly control the 0G Chain validators or the Protocol’s smart contracts, which execute autonomously on-chain.

4.2 a0G Liquid Staking Token

Upon staking 0G tokens, the Protocol’s smart contracts issue a0G tokens at the then-current exchange rate. The a0G-to-0G exchange rate increases over time as staking rewards accumulate; the amount of 0G redeemable per a0G may be greater at redemption than at staking. The exchange rate may decrease in the event of a slashing event. The a0G tokens are: (a) a technical on-chain representation of staking participation, not a security, investment contract, fund unit, or regulated financial instrument in any jurisdiction; (b) not a claim, liability, or debt of Ascend; (c) not a guarantee of any reward, return, or yield; and (d) not legal tender. The characterization of a0G may differ under the laws of different jurisdictions. You are responsible for compliance with applicable law in your jurisdiction.

6. Staking, Unstaking, and Fees

To stake 0G tokens, submit a staking transaction via the Interface. Upon on-chain confirmation, the Protocol issues a0G tokens at the then-current exchange rate. All staking transactions are irreversible once submitted.

To redeem your staked position, submit an unstaking request. Your a0G tokens will be burned and your 0G tokens will enter an unbonding period of approximately 22 days. During unbonding, your 0G tokens earn no rewards, are not accessible or transferable, and remain subject to slashing. Ascend does not control the unbonding period, which is a 0G Chain network parameter subject to governance change.

The Protocol charges a fee on staking rewards, automatically applied before rewards are added to the staking pool and reflected in the a0G exchange rate. The current fee rate is published on the Interface and may be modified upon notice. You are solely responsible for all network gas fees. Third-party protocols charge their own fees for which Ascend is not responsible.
